How To Use A Cutting In Brush. A good quality paintbrush is equally as important as a quality paint, so make sure that you don’t shortcut on your brush. Don't overload and the paint will drip. Wet the bristles of your paintbrush with clean water. Dip the brush into the paint, then tap (don’t wipe) each side against your container to knock off the excess. Aubrey demonstrates how to cut in with a paint brush to produce straight lines. Start by loading paint onto the brush and patting down both sides.
